[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I can't speak to the Stokes experience at all, but I can share I have multiple kids who have gone through ITDS, from pk3 to 8th grade graduate. In general we've had a good experience. With a small school, sometimes it can be hard for a student to find their friend group or to deal with other kids who are bothering them so I know some families have struggled when their kid is experiencing social issues/bullying. It hasn't been an issue in our family but noting it. We've had strong social connections with families (easier when you start when your kid is younger), and kids are doing very well academically. I'm not sure what the PP meant about being overtly progressive, but as a family with multiple, non-dominant identities it's been a safe and welcoming (not just tolerant) place for us on multiple levels. They've expanded the building to be able to use the basement as a learning and enrichment space (with tons of natural light) but sometimes the classrooms or other flex spaces can feel tight. Having the Edgewood field and playground right behind the school offers great space and resources beyond what the school offers directly. The staff cares deeply for the kids. [/quote] As a family of color, this was not our experience at ITDS, though admittedly we were there some time ago and for not as long as PP. We found that there were definitely some among both the administration and the families who claim to be progressive but are very white-centering. YMMV, obviously.[/quote]
